Types of Tall Succulents

There are many different types of tall succulents, each with its unique characteristics. Here are a few of the most popular types:

Snake Plant (Sansevieria trifasciata)

The snake plant is a popular choice for those looking for a tall succulent. Its long, stiff leaves can grow up to four feet tall and come in various shades of green. Snake plants are easy to care for and can tolerate low light levels, making them perfect for indoor spaces.

Yucca Plant (Yucca elephantipes)

The yucca plant is a striking succulent with long, sword-shaped leaves that grow in a rosette pattern. These plants can grow up to six feet tall and are popular for their unique shape and texture.

Agave Plant (Agave americana)

The agave plant is a dramatic succulent with long, pointed leaves that grow in a rosette pattern. These plants can grow up to ten feet tall and are often used as a focal point in a garden or landscape.

Caring for Tall Succulents

While tall succulents are low maintenance, they still require some care to thrive. Here are some tips for caring for your tall succulents:

Light Requirements

Most tall succulents require bright, indirect light. Place your plant near a window or in a well-lit area of your home or office.

Watering

Tall succulents do not require frequent watering. Water your plant when the soil is dry to the touch, typically once every two weeks.

Soil

Tall succulents require well-draining soil to prevent root rot. Use a cactus or succulent mix for best results.
